无论是金融、医疗、零售还是科技行业,生产数据库作为存储和处理核心业务数据的基石,其稳定性和安全性直接关系到企业的运营效率和客户信任
然而,随着业务需求的不断变化和技术迭代,生产数据库的变更成为常态
如何在频繁的数据库变更中确保数据的安全与完整性,备份策略显得尤为重要
本文将深入探讨生产数据库变更备份的重要性、实施步骤、最佳实践以及面临的挑战与解决方案,旨在为企业构建一道坚不可摧的数据安全防线
一、生产数据库变更备份的重要性 1. 数据安全的首要保障 生产数据库变更可能涉及数据结构的调整、新功能的添加或旧功能的移除等,这些操作一旦失误,可能导致数据丢失或损坏
定期且全面的备份能够迅速恢复数据至变更前的状态,有效防止数据灾难的发生
2. 业务连续性的基石 在竞争激烈的市场环境中,业务中断意味着客户流失和经济损失
通过高效的备份与恢复机制,企业可以在最短时间内恢复数据库服务,确保业务连续性,减少因数据问题导致的服务中断时间
3. 合规性与审计要求 许多行业受到严格的监管,要求企业保留特定时间段内的数据记录以供审计
完善的备份策略不仅满足合规要求,还能在必要时提供准确的数据证据,维护企业的法律地位
二、实施生产数据库变更备份的步骤 1. 需求分析与规划 首先,明确备份的目的、范围、频率和恢复时间目标(RTO)及恢复点目标(RPO)
根据业务需求和数据库特性,选择合适的备份类型(如全量备份、增量备份、差异备份)和存储介质
2. 备份工具与技术的选择 市场上存在多种数据库备份软件和服务,如Oracle RMAN、MySQL mysqldump、第三方备份解决方案等
选择时需考虑工具的兼容性、自动化程度、性能以及对特定数据库特性的支持
3. 制定备份策略 包括备份时间窗口的选择(避开业务高峰期)、备份数据的加密与压缩、备份文件的命名与存储结构、以及备份日志的管理等
确保备份过程既高效又安全
4. 自动化与监控 实施自动化备份作业,减少人为错误,同时建立监控机制,实时跟踪备份任务的执行状态,及时发现并解决潜在问题
5. 测试与验证 定期进行备份恢复测试,确保备份数据的可用性和准确性
这包括模拟灾难场景下的快速恢复演练,以及日常的数据一致性检查
三、最佳实践 1. 分级存储策略 结合本地存储与云存储,实现成本效益与数据访问速度的最佳平衡
关键数据可存储在高性能本地磁盘,非关键或历史数据则迁移至成本较低的云存储
2. 数据去重与压缩 采用数据去重和压缩技术减少备份数据量,节省存储空间,同时加快备份和恢复速度
3. 异地容灾备份 建立异地备份中心,实现数据的地理分散存储,以应对区域性灾难(如地震、洪水)对数据中心的破坏
4. 强化访问控制与审计 实施严格的备份数据访问权限管理,记录所有备份和恢复操作的日志,便于追踪和审计
四、面临的挑战与解决方案 1. 数据量激增 随着大数据时代的到来,生产数据库规模迅速膨胀,给备份带来巨大挑战
解决方案包括采用分布式存储架构、优化备份算法以及利用云服务的弹性扩展能力
2. 备份窗口缩短 业务7x24小时运行模式下,留给备份的时间窗口越来越短
通过增量/差异备份、并行处理技术和智能调度算法,可以有效缩短备份时间
3. 数据一致性问题 数据库在备份过程中可能处于活动状态,导致数据不一致
采用快照技术或暂停非关键业务操作进行一致性备份,是常见的解决方案
4. 成本考量 备份存储和运维成本是企业必须面对的现实问题
通过精细化的备份策略、高效的存储利用以及采用成本效益高的云服务,可以有效控制成本
五、结语 生产数据库变更备份不仅是技术层面的操作,更是企业战略的重要组成部分
它关乎企业的数据安全、业务连续性和合规性,是企业稳健发展的基石
面对日益复杂的数据环境和不断变化的业务需求,企业应持续优化备份策略,采用先进的技术手段,构建灵活、高效、安全的备份体系
同时,加强员工培训和意识提升,确保从管理层到一线员工都能深刻理解备份的重要性,共同守护企业的数据财富
只有这样,才能在激烈的市场竞争中立于不败之地,实现可持续发展